Exile On Main Street Blues
(Mick Jagger / Keith Richards)
Sunset Sound Studios, Hollywood, Los Angeles, California, US, March 28, 1972
Mick Jagger - vocals, piano

Produced by Jimmy Miller
First released on:
The Rolling Stones - “Exile On Main Street” 7” flexi single
(New Musical Express Magazine) UK, April 29, 1972
